git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@7634
48e7efb5-ca39-0410-a469-
dd3cf9ba447f
if (IS_TRACING_PROCESSES){
//processes grouped by host
pajeDefineContainerType("PROCESS", "HOST", "PROCESS");
if (IS_TRACING_PROCESSES){
//processes grouped by host
pajeDefineContainerType("PROCESS", "HOST", "PROCESS");
+ pajeDefineStateType("category", "PROCESS", "category");
pajeDefineStateType("presence", "PROCESS", "presence");
}
pajeDefineStateType("presence", "PROCESS", "presence");
}
if (!xbt_dict_get_or_null (process_containers, alias)){
if (IS_TRACING_PROCESSES) pajeCreateContainer (MSG_get_clock(), alias, "PROCESS", MSG_host_get_name(host), name);
if (IS_TRACING_PROCESSES) pajePushState (MSG_get_clock(), "presence", alias, "presence");
if (!xbt_dict_get_or_null (process_containers, alias)){
if (IS_TRACING_PROCESSES) pajeCreateContainer (MSG_get_clock(), alias, "PROCESS", MSG_host_get_name(host), name);
if (IS_TRACING_PROCESSES) pajePushState (MSG_get_clock(), "presence", alias, "presence");
+ if (IS_TRACING_PROCESSES) pajeSetState (MSG_get_clock(), "category", alias, process->category);
xbt_dict_set (process_containers, xbt_strdup(alias), xbt_strdup("1"), xbt_free);
return 0;
}else{
xbt_dict_set (process_containers, xbt_strdup(alias), xbt_strdup("1"), xbt_free);
return 0;
}else{